No memory seats=no Lux package, which has more in it than just the memory and the wipers.

http://www.lexus.com/models/IS/featu...ion%20Packages


An AWD cars options would possibly include-

Premium (it has this if it has woodgrain)

Luxury (it would have memory seats, plus a buncha other stuff)

Nav

Mark Levinson (this is available with or without nav)

XM

Headlamp washers

HIDs (this is available as a standalone as well as being part of the Lux package)

PCS (radar cruise, very rare, and pricey)

Rear Spoiler

Park Assist
